The complainant has requested information about data breaches over the previous ten years. The Commissioner's decision is that the Department for Work and Pensions (DWP) is entitled to rely on section 12(1), cost of compliance exceeds the appropriate limit, to refuse to comply with the request. The Commissioner is also satisfied that DWP has provided adequate advice and assistance in accordance with its obligations with 16(1). The Commissioner does however find that DWP breached section 17(5) by failing to provide the refusal notice within the statutory timeframe. The Commissioner does not require any steps.
